Garden & Ecology Notes
- Wildlife Value:
- birds, insects, small mammals
- Fire Ecology:
- Fire adapted — tolerates or benefits from fire
- Fire Notes:
- As a miombo woodland species, Brachystegia utilis is adapted to periodic fire and resprouts from the root crown following burns.
Propagation & Germination
- Scarification:
- Seed coat scarification required before sowing
- Germination Time:
- 14–42 days
- Notes:
- Seeds benefit from scarification due to hard seed coat. Fresh seed germinates more readily than stored seed.
